Once the Add/Drop period has ended, you have until the grade option change deadline to either change your grade option or audit the course.  You would submit the Grade Option/Audit Request form to the school offering the course.

If you are auditing the course, please be advised that you must be registered for the course you are auditing, and tuition is charged as normal for audited courses.  For more information about payments, please reach out to the Student Payment Center 

If you are student in the School of Computing and Information (SCI) and would like to add or change your major in SCI, please complete the SCI Undergraduate Major Declaration Form. Any declaration forms received before or during the Add/Drop period of term will be processed effective for that term.  Please note, due to the number of forms received and processing times, you may not see the change reflected on your record for a couple of weeks after the Add/Drop period has passed.  Declarations received after Add/Drop will be processed for the following semester.

If you are not currently a student in SCI and want to declare an SCI major, you must first apply and be accepted as an SCI internal transfer or double degree student.  Please reach out to your home school for the correct form to start this process.  You can find more information on admission requirements on the SCI Undergraduate Admissions page 

To emphasize a multidisciplinary approach, SCI undergraduate students are required to have a minimum of two areas of focus.  This requirement can be satisfied by:

  • Completion of a jointly offered major with another school on campus
  • Completion of a minor or second major
  • an approved certificate program

If none of the options fit your situation, you will need to work with your advisor to build an area of focus and submit this Secondary Field of Study (SFoS) Declaration. If you are unsure if this requirement is fulfilled, reach out to your advisor.

After the add/drop period has ended, you may withdraw from a course by completing a Monitored Withdrawal Request form.  Submit this form for all SCI courses no later than the monitored withdrawal deadline published in the University’s Academic Calendar for the term. All forms must be received by 5:00 PM Eastern Time. 

 NOTICE: Starting in the Fall 2025 term, withdrawals from a course now count as an official attempt. This means that they count towards the number of repeats you have when taking a course.  Students can only repeat a course twice, for a total of three attempts.  You can see the policy update here: https://www.provost.pitt.edu/course-repeat.  For questions about the impact of a Withdrawal on your record, please reach out to your advisor.

Undergraduate students can cross-register for courses through the Pittsburgh Council on Higher Education (PCHE) program.  Students can be cross registered between their home school and another participating school to take courses not offered at their home institution.  Students who are interested in enrolling in a course at a PCHE institution must submit the advisor signed PCHE Cross Registration Form to SCI Academic Records by the deadline determined by the University of Pittsburgh Registrar's office.  Once the form is submitted, Academic Records will obtain the required Dean’s signature and route to the Registrar’s Office for final processing.

Academic Records automatically submits the Registrar’s Course Repeat Form for students who have repeated the exact same course (i.e., repeating INFSCI 0017). However, any student who is replacing a course with an established comparable one (i.e., replacing INFSCI 0017 with CMPINF 0401), must submit a Course Repeat Form to their Advisor PRIOR to enrollment. The advisor will review course repeat policies with the student and submit the form to Records on behalf of the student at the end of the term.

The SCI Undergraduate Transfer Credit Request Form is for current SCI students looking to take courses at another institution and transfer the credit back to their University of Pittsburgh record.

Students are eligible to bring in transfer credit during their time at Pitt if they meet the following requirements:

  • Student is in good academic standing
  • Student has not completed 90 credits of course work prior to the transfer of the away course
  • Student has not previously completed proposed course work at the University of Pittsburgh

Questions about eligibility should be discussed with your advisor.

Forms will be accepted beginning after add/drop in the term before you are taking the course. i.e., if you plan to take a course at another school in Summer 2026, the earliest you can submit the form is after add/drop in Spring 2026.
